David Shaw founded D. E. Shaw & Co., a pioneering quantitative investment firm that helped define systematic trading at scale. With a background in computer science, Shaw built teams that applied advanced computation to markets across equities, derivatives, and other assets. The firm remains one of the most important quant platforms in global finance, even as Shaw’s own public role has shifted over time.

David Shaw's Q2 2022 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2022, David Shaw held 6,080 positions worth $85.3B, down 20% from $107B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 8.5% of the portfolio.

David Shaw withdrew a net $8.25B in Q2 2022, closing 791 positions and reducing 1,835 holdings. Its most notable exit was Dominion Energy, Inc. 2019 Series A Corporate Units, an estimated $64.1M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 12% of assets, down from 14%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Healthcare.

Against the trend, David Shaw opened a new position in iShares MSCI Emerging Markets ETF worth $171M.

  • David Shaw's largest Q2 2022 buy was iShares MSCI Emerging Markets ETF: 4,273,656 shares worth $171M.
  • David Shaw added most to iShares iBoxx $ Investment Grade Corporate Bond ETF in Q2 2022, an estimated $510M increase.
  • David Shaw's biggest Q2 2022 reduction was Marathon Petroleum, cutting an estimated $573M.
  • David Shaw fully exited Dominion Energy, Inc. 2019 Series A Corporate Units in Q2 2022, selling an estimated $64.1M.
  • David Shaw's ten largest holdings make up 8.5% of its $85.3B portfolio in Q2 2022.
  • David Shaw opened 595 new positions and closed 791 in Q2 2022.
  • David Shaw's portfolio value fell 20% quarter-over-quarter to $85.3B.

Based on D.E. Shaw & Co's 13F filing for Q2 2022, filed 15 Aug 2022.
